ABS light on. 1997 V90 S90-V90

I'm surprised no one commented that this is a very common problem for the 97 and some 98's. If the light just stays on, yes, by all means check the wheel sensors. However your problem is most likely in the module atop the ABS brake unit. It is poorly located close to the exhaust and is prone to heat failure. A couple of years ago, when mine failed, there was a huge amount of stuff posted about this. Some people managed to resolder the board in the module. The unit needs better heat insulation and a heat sink to get the heat away from the board before individual components are affected. You will probably find somewhere on the board references to a guy named Vitor. Vitor is actually Victor, here in L.A. If you send him your module he'll rebuild it for you at a fraction of dealer cost. Does a fine job, wonderful guy, and our 850 never suffered a relapse. Of course you need that silly Torx socket to get the unit off, but such is life. I suggest you try searching for "vitor" on the board, or "vitor ABS" perhaps.
